Why this matters for the Core Web Vitals, and where to start fixing it

A layout shift score multiplies how much of the viewport moved by how far it moved. One full-width block jumping down can fail the CLS threshold on its own. The largest single shift tells you whether a site has that one dominant event or death by a thousand small ones.

If the largest shift carries most of the total, the work is finding one element. The usual suspects: a hero image without dimensions, a banner injected above the content, a font swap that reflows the page. Reserve the space that element needs and the problem is gone.

How does this affect the Core Web Vitals?

Largest shift is part of the CLS itself, so this is arithmetic, not correlation. Where the largest shift is low, 94% of sites pass the CLS. Where it is high, 71% do. The decline is gradual. There is no point where sites suddenly start failing.
